IP Security (IPsec)
Configured in [TCP/IP] 9 [Security].
IPsec is a set of standards for encrypted communication over the
Internet. It provides effective security for both wireless and wired LANs.
To use this function, you must enable IPsec in the network settings of
the computer. When the camera's IPsec is employed, only transport
mode is supported, and 3DES or AES encryption and SHA-1
authentication are used. Note that the IP address of the computer for
communication with the camera must be entered in [Destination
address] on the settings screen.
